When does this happen?

IF Users cannot run Replicate public models (e.g., Llama 3) via LangChain because a version string is required, but Replicate's own API does not require one for public models.

How others solved it

THEN Update the LangChain Replicate wrapper to make the version parameter optional. For public models, if no version is provided, the wrapper should default to the latest version, matching Replicate's API behavior. This involves modifying the Replicate class in langchain_community.llms to remove the version requirement for public model identifiers.

from langchain_community.llms import Replicate
# Instead of requiring a version:
model = Replicate(model="meta/meta-llama-3-70b-instruct")
# The wrapper should automatically use the latest version.
